Introduction
As a home owner, acknowledging signs that suggest your home demands immediate plumbing attention is crucial for avoiding pricey damages and inconvenience. Let's discover a few of the leading indicators you need to never ever disregard.
Decreased Water Pressure
One of the most common indicators of plumbing issues is lowered water stress. If you observe a substantial decrease in water stress in your taps or showerheads, it could signal underlying troubles such as pipeline leaks, mineral buildup, or concerns with the water supply line.

Insect Infestations
Parasites such as roaches, rodents, and bugs are drawn in to moisture and water resources, making water leaks and broken pipelines optimal breeding grounds. If you notice a boost in parasite task, maybe a sign of plumbing problems that require to be dealt with.
Slow Drain
Slow-moving drainage is one more warning that shouldn't be forgotten. If water takes longer than normal to drain pipes from sinks, showers, or bath tubs, it might show a clog in the pipes. Neglecting this issue might cause complete blockages and prospective water damage.
Unexpected Boost in Water Expenses
If you observe an unexpected spike in your water expenses without an equivalent boost in usage, it's a strong sign of covert leaks. Also little leaks can waste substantial quantities of water in time, resulting in filled with air water bills.
Weird Noises
Gurgling, knocking, or whistling sounds coming from your plumbing system are not normal and must be checked out promptly. These sounds could be caused by problems such as air in the pipelines, loosened fittings, or water hammer-- a sensation where water flow is suddenly quit.
Structure Cracks
Cracks in your home's structure may signify underlying plumbing issues, particularly if they accompany water-related troubles indoors. Water leaks from pipelines or sewer lines can trigger soil disintegration, leading to foundation settlement and fractures.
Mold and mildew Development
The presence of mold or mildew in your home, especially in damp or improperly aerated locations, indicates excess wetness-- a typical effect of water leaks. Mold not only damages surface areas yet additionally poses wellness risks to residents, making timely plumbing repair work crucial.
Unpleasant Smells
Foul odors originating from drains pipes or sewer lines are not only undesirable yet additionally indicative of plumbing issues. Drain odors may recommend a harmed drain line or a dried-out P-trap, while musty scents can signal mold development from water leakages.
Noticeable Water Damages
Water stains on wall surfaces or ceilings, as well as mold or mildew growth, are clear signs of water leaks that need instant interest. Neglecting these indicators can lead to structural damage, compromised indoor air quality, and expensive repair work.
Final thought
Recognizing the indicators that your home needs immediate plumbing interest is important for preventing substantial damages and pricey repairs. By remaining alert and resolving plumbing issues immediately, you can keep a safe, practical, and comfy living setting for you and your family.
HOW TO KNOW IF YOUR HOUSE NEEDS PLUMBING MAINTENANCE?
Your home’s plumbing system plays a vital role in ensuring the smooth flow of water and maintaining a comfortable living environment. However, over time, wear and tear can occur, leading to plumbing issues that can disrupt your daily routine. To avoid costly repairs and unexpected emergencies, regular plumbing maintenance is essential. If you are asking how to know if your house needs a plumbing maintenance, here are some key signs to watch for and maintenance tips to keep your home’s water systems in excellent condition.
Watch for Warning Signs.
Several indicators can suggest that your home needs plumbing maintenance. These signs include slow drainage, low water pressure, recurring leaks, foul odors, and unusual sounds coming from the pipes. Pay attention to these warnings as they can indicate underlying issues that require immediate attention.
Schedule Regular Inspections.
Preventive maintenance is crucial to catch plumbing problems before they escalate. Consider scheduling regular inspections with a professional plumber who can assess your plumbing system for any hidden leaks, corrosion, or potential issues. Regular inspections can help you identify problems early on, saving you from costly repairs and water damage.
Maintain Drainage Systems.
Clogged drains are a common plumbing issue that can lead to water backups and other complications. Avoid pouring grease, coffee grounds, or other debris down the drain, and use drain covers to prevent hair and debris from entering the pipes. Regularly clean your drains using natural remedies or approved drain cleaners to keep them clear. Winterize Your Plumbing.
In colder climates, freezing temperatures can cause pipes to burst, leading to significant water damage. Before the winter season arrives, insulate exposed pipes, disconnect outdoor hoses, and consider installing pipe insulation sleeves. Taking these preventive measures can protect your plumbing system during freezing weather.
Regular plumbing maintenance is essential for a well-functioning home. By paying attention to warning signs, scheduling inspections, maintaining drainage systems, and winterizing your plumbing, you can prevent costly repairs and ensure a smoothly running water system. Remember, proactive maintenance is the key to a hassle-free and functional home.
